Dragon Bridge: The Nighttime Spectacle
Your first stop is the famous Dragon Bridge, which is more than just a bridge—it’s a symbol of Da Nang’s modern vitality. Built to resemble a mythical dragon, the bridge is best appreciated after dark when its lighting system creates a fiery, animated display.
The real highlight is the evening light show, which is often synchronized with music or special events. The guide notes that “the lighting and the dragon’s movement are mesmerizing,” making it a favorite for photos and memorable moments. The bridge typically stays illuminated for about an hour, giving you plenty of time to appreciate the craftsmanship and take photos.
Helio Night Market: A Foodie Paradise
Next, you’re whisked away to Helio Night Market, a bustling hub of activity where local vendors peddle everything from handmade crafts to street food. This stop is a highlight for many guests because of the delicious, affordable food options.
Expect to find familiar Vietnamese favorites such as fresh spring rolls, savory banh mi, grilled seafood, and sweet desserts. Many reviewers mention that the market’s lively atmosphere is contagious, and the variety of aromas makes it hard to resist trying multiple dishes. One guest said, “Sampling the street food felt authentic and was so much better than any restaurant meal.”
The two-hour duration allows for a relaxed pace, so you can explore, browse, and indulge at your leisure.
Han River: Scenic Cruise with City Lights
The final part of the tour is a shared cruise along the Han River, which is especially magical at night. The boat glides silently past the illuminated bridges and skyline, offering sweeping views of Da Nang’s glowing buildings and landmarks.
Guests often comment on how peaceful and scenic this part is. “The views of the lit-up bridges and city skyline are breathtaking,” noted one reviewer. The cruise lasts approximately an hour, giving enough time to relax and take photos. It’s an ideal way to wind down after a busy evening of sightseeing and food.

FAQs

Is hotel pickup included?
Yes, the tour includes pickup from your hotel in Da Nang’s city center, making the experience hassle-free.
How long does the tour last?
It lasts approximately 4 hours and 30 minutes, starting at 5:00 pm and returning around 9:30-10 pm.
What’s the main highlight of the tour?
The Han River cruise and the Dragon Bridge lighting show are often considered the most memorable parts.
Are tickets included?
Yes, admission tickets for the Dragon Bridge, Helio Night Market, and the cruise are all included in the price.
Can I join this tour with a group?
Yes, it’s a private tour, so only your group will participate, providing a personalized experience.
Is this tour suitable for kids?
Most travelers find it family-friendly, especially since it involves sightseeing and food tasting, but check with your guide about specific age considerations.
What should I bring?
Bring your camera, cash for extras, comfortable shoes, and a light jacket if needed for the evening.
